As anticipated above, in SLAVE mode the internal oscillator operates at 250 kHz typ. but the
slope compensation is dimensioned accordingly with FSW resistors so, even if the A6985F
supports synchronization over the 275 kHz - 2 MHz frequency range, it is important to limit
the switching operation around a working point close to the selected frequency (FSW
resistor).
As a consequence, to guarantee the full output current capability and to prevent the
subharmonic oscillations the master must limit the driving frequency range within ± 20% of
the selected frequency.
A wider frequency range may generate subharmonic oscillation for duty > 50% or limit the
peak current capability (see IPK parameter in Table 5 on page 8) since the internal slope
compensation signal may be saturated.

Design of the power components
7.6.1
Input capacitor selection
The input capacitor voltage rating must be higher than the maximum input operating voltage
of the application. During the switching activity a pulsed current flows into the input capacitor
and so its RMS current capability must be selected accordingly with the application
conditions. Internal losses of the input filter depends on the ESR value so usually low ESR
capacitors (like multilayer ceramic capacitors) have higher RMS current capability. On the
other hand, given the RMS current value, lower ESR input filter has lower losses and so
contributes to higher conversion efficiency.
The maximum RMS input current flowing through the capacitor can be calculated as:
Equation 44
Where IOUT is the maximum DC output current, D is the duty cycles, is the efficiency. This
function has a maximum at D = 0.5 and, considering
 = 1, it is equal to IOUT/2.
In a specific application the range of possible duty cycles has to be considered in order to
find out the maximum RMS input current. The maximum and minimum duty cycles can be
calculated as:
Equation 45
Equation 46
Where
VHIGH_SIDE and VLOW_SIDE are the voltage drops across the embedded switches.
